Mobile Technology Report Awards Signal the Dawn of a New Digital Age

LONDON, December 18, 2013 /PRNewswire/ --

    The tradition of using mobile phones simply for making and receiving calls has long
been forgotten, as today's mobile computing powerhouses serve innumerable and ever-more
complex possibilities and processes. The modern incarnation of the mobile phone has, this
year in particular, stood at the forefront of so many advances in the digital age, and
expanded the connectivity of consumers in developed and developing markets like never
before.

    Each of the last few years has at some point been named 'the year of the mobile', but
if you were to pick a standout year it would most certainly be 2013. To celebrate this
most momentous of years, we at The New Economy are taking the opportunity to name the 2013
Mobile Technology Report Award winners and recognise the best the sector has to offer.

    The Mobile Technology Report Awards recognise those who have really revolutionised the
sector these past 12 months. Whether they're working in the field of mobile payments,
enterprise, business intelligence, data, devices, apps, platforms or productivity, each
awardee has been equally instrumental in pioneering the very latest innovations and
advances in the mobile arena.

    To see 2013's Mobile Technology Report Award winners, the full list is included in an
extensive supplement to the new Winter edition of The New Economy, available online and in
print now.
